It is great place to visit! Can see the ocean, Vulcano (active one) ,lake...beautiful panorama. Gondola is going every 15mins, it was aroud 1500yen, if you are coming with car to the base of mountain, parkig is 500yen. This place is 1day trip. Nice park, museum, to see remains of the old village after eruption of the Vulcano. Prepare camera, many things to see here. There is hiking trail around crater, it is ~ 1.1km long one. It is a nice story about Volcano research, don't miss to hear it. On your way back, go to some Hot spring/onsen around Lake Toya.

After taking the cable car up, simply walked out of the cable car station, then turn left to the observatory (There’s a flight of stairs). Breathtaking view of Mt Usu and also the surroundings. There is a 600 steps path down to the crater observatory which takes 45-60min (one way trip). As it’s a dead end, you must walk back the 600 steps (now up) which is challenging with the thinner air making it harder to breathe. Pls take note of how long you need to walk so as to plan nicely for the cable car timings!

This is a UNESCO Geo-Park. It is an amazing and beautiful place. You can take a gondola up to an outdoor/indoor observatory area at the top of one of the mountains, and have a view of both Toya lake and the ocean, as well as the active volcano. There are several smaller tourist sites in the area documenting various eruptions. The volcano erupted 3 times in the 20th century. No one was injured in the most recent eruption.
